Hi All.
I'm trying out wing on Ubuntu 7.0.4 and am running into a glitch. First
some useful stuff:
jaime at elizabeth:~/Desktop/wingide-2.1.4-2-i386-linux$ uname -a
Linux elizabeth 2.6.20-16-generic #2 SMP Thu Jun 7 19:00:28 UTC 2007 x86_64
GNU/Linux
^^ As you can see, I'm trying to install / run 2.1.4
I install with this command:
jaime at elizabeth:~/Desktop/wingide-2.1.4-2-i386-linux$ sudo python
wing-install.py
I accept the defaults, which places files in:
/usr/local/lib/wingide2.1
When I try to run wing, I get this error ->
jaime at elizabeth:~/Desktop/wingide-2.1.4-2-i386-linux$ wing2.1
exec: 192: /usr/local/lib/wingide2.1/bin/PyCore/python: not found
But, that path does exist ->
jaime at elizabeth:~/Desktop/wingide-2.1.4-2-i386-linux$ ls -l
/usr/local/lib/wingide2.1/bin/PyCore/python
-rwxr-xr-x 1 root root 973416 2007-02-08 00:10
/usr/local/lib/wingide2.1/bin/PyCore/python
Any ideas?
